Shah Rukh Khan and Aryan Khan to voice Mufasa and Simba in Hindi version of The Lion King.

Disney’s classic ‘The Lion King’ is becoming a live action movie. The film is a much loved 1994 film. The film is much anticipated rendition and one that fans are looking forward to.

While Shah Rukh Khan will voice the character of Mufasa, the wise King of the Pride Lands, his son Aryan Khan will lend his voice to Simba, the primary character.

The latest news is that the King of Bollywood Shahrukh Khan will be giving his voice for Mufasa while his son Aryan Khan will be playing Simba. This is certainly huge and will surely draw in a large crowd who would just come in to hear their favorite Khan as Mufasa.

Aryan Khan will be making his debut with this film. The film has been directed by The Jungle Book director Jon Favreau. The film is slated for release on 19 July 2019 in English, Hindi, Tamil, and Telugu.

Shah Rukh Khan on Sunday had teased the news by posting a photo with Aryan that showed themselves clad in the blue colours of Indian cricket team with Mufasa and Simba written on their tees.
